The World’s Best Banks 2009

The Global Finance magazine has published the best banks for 2009 in the global, regional and country categories. The list includes the best banks in 123 countries and 11 key banking categories. The winners were selected based on both objective and subjective criteria.”Objective criteria included growth in assets, profitability, geographic reach, strategic relationships, new business …
